    From what Steve Winn (current developer) noted, "the entire code of
    the tosser (VFIDO) would have to be completely redone to fix the
    problem".

    quite frankly, bullshit... i added a MSGID routine to an app i had never seen before that someone else was attempting to work with... it was quite simple to add another pascal unit with the necessary routines and then use the one routine that was needed... that app hasn't produced any dupes since... the same thing could easily be done in any other language... hell, just use a simple serial number that increments on each use and that'll fix it as long as the operator doesn't overwrite the data file containing the serial number data when they continually restore backups over and over ;)
